Founded in 2008 upon a generous gift from Jimmy and Dee Haslam and Jim and Natalie Haslam, the Haslam Scholars Program at the University of Tennessee, Knoxville, has flourished as a unique and diverse honors enrichment program in which top students learn from and with one another through a series of integrated, interdisciplinary seminars and extracurricular experiences. Haslam Scholars serve as high-profile undergraduate leaders whose lofty academic ambitions match those of the program and the institution.

2011 “Running for Hope”

On November 12, 2011, members of the Haslam Scholars Program executed their first self-organized philanthropic project, a 5K Run to raise funds for Redeeming Hope Ministries.  Over 250 runners registered for the 5K or the 1 mile “fun run.” The students raised close to $7,000 for the local non-profit organization, whose mission is holistic transformation [...]
